He has stayed in Pueblo before moving to Pueblo. Russell S Chavez, Kathryn Chavez, Kathryn Ann Chavez and 2 other people are people possibly related to Alexander. 1935 is his birth date. Alexander has listed (719) 542-6617 as his phone number. Alexander was born 88 years ago. Alexander currently resides at 1455 Cody Ave, Pueblo, Co 81001.